Upstream graph

The networks AS39775 is seen behind, one and two hops out, drawn from real AS paths.

Networks observed one and two hops upstream of AS39775 in real AS paths. A thicker line means more vantage points saw that adjacency, so weight tracks how well attested it is — not how much traffic it carries. Adjacency is an observation; whether it is a transit purchase or a settlement-free peering is an inference, and is labelled as one wherever we show it.
